背景重复模糊图片的颜色?

时间:2013-09-26 23:13:39

标签: css png background-repeat

我目前正在尝试设计一些Call-to-action按钮,我已经制作了一个动态宽度按钮,它由左右容器构成,然后是一个容纳所有文本的中间容器。

中间的图片是50像素并重复。

我的问题是,当图片大于< = 50px时,背景图片中的绿色显示正确。当它> 50px(并且背景图片重复)时,绿色似乎改变。

有谁知道我做错了什么?

这是两张显示问题的图片:

模糊的一个:http://d.pr/i/fz2b

正确的一个:http://d.pr/i/cjgp

编辑:

我这样做:

<a href="#">
    <div class="left"></div>
    <div class="middle">Link text here</div>
    <div class="right"></div>
</a>

我在.left和.right中的背景并没有重复。我的背景图片只是在溢出时重复 - 当它溢出时,图片会改变它的绿色。 : - )

1 个答案:

答案 0 :(得分:-1)

你没有做错任何事。这是因为Image延伸模糊,而不是尝试在具有适当背景颜色的div中使用png图像

这是一个例子

Fiddle

这是一个简单的HTML

<div class="cont">
<img src="http://www.iconsdb.com/icons/preview/moth-green/right-circular-xxl.png" class="img"/>

如果您有任何疑问,请告诉我